Staff Recommendation
APPROVE variances 1 - 5 because the site's topography restricts compliance with the Subdivision Regulations, and the proposed variances will not create a traffic hazard.
APPROVE the Concept Plan subject to 13 conditions:
1. Connection to sanitary sewer and meeting any other relevant requirements of the Knox County Health Department
2. Certification on the design plan and final plat by the applicant's surveyor that there is 300 feet of sight distance in both directions on Mourfield Rd. from the proposed subdivision entrance road
3. Place a note on the final plat that all lots will have access from the internal street system only
4. Provision of the stream buffers as required by the Knox County Dept. of Engineering and Public Works
5. Meeting all applicable requirements of the Knox County Stormwater Control Ordinance
6. Meeting all other applicable requirements of the Knox County Department of Engineering and Public Works.
7. Constructing a sidewalk on one side of each street within the development. The sidewalks are to be a minimum of 5 ' wide with a 2' wide planting strip behind the curb. All sidewalk construction is to be ADA compliant
8. Constructing sidewalks as shown on the plan at the time the roads and other infrastructure are being constructed/installed
9. Complete the grading required to allow for the future construction of a sidewalk along Mourfield Rd. from the subdivision entrance to the northern boundary of the site
10. Designate the area on lots 30-36 that is beyond the limits of grading, as shown on the grading plan, as an area that is to remain undisturbed
11. Providing a 30' wide greenway easement along the northern boundary of the site or as requested by the Knox County Greenways Coordinator
12. Establishment of a homeowners association for the purpose of maintaining the stormwater control system and any other commonly held assets
13. A final plat application based on this concept plan will not be accepted for review by the MPC until certification of design plan approval has been submitted to the MPC staff.
